Current thesis
The company-source Q1 release supports a cautious positive operating read: Brookfield posted record FFO, highlighted Boralex as a scale acquisition, cited signed and closed asset-sales proceeds, and reiterated development growth ambitions. Those items provide real company-specific hooks rather than only a generic renewable-power sentiment call.

What can break
A meaningful part of the positive narrative depends on asset sales, recycling, and acquisition execution, including Boralex integration and announced monetizations closing on expected terms.
